Knee arthroscopy (meniscus shave, chrondroplasty, and lateral release) last week… While I could walk the day of (with stiffness and mild pain/discomfort) I used crutches with *some weight bearing the first two days. By the third day, I was walking with minimal pain/discomfort and stiffness, and had a near normal gait pattern. I’m at day 6 and have essentially no pain/discomfort, very little stiffness, and have been able resume all normal activities (minus working out to the level I did before). PT exercises and stretches (2x daily), frequent icing, and walking have helped tremendously. I was told 6 weeks for full recovery from my osteo (based on my age, fitness/health, and activity level)… I was extremely skeptical at first, but am now rather optimistic. BL based on my experience - Pain, stiffness, and recovery are relative and will differ from person to person.
